L.T. Filiaga

LB, Bingham High School

Signed with Utah

Coach's comment: "He's another one of a long list of big, fast, physical Bingham linebackers. He's not just a great football player, he's a great kid. He's a natural leader. He has great speed and physicality. He was able to make plays on us the last two years. He's difficult to get a body on. I think he's going to be a huge asset to the U."

— Alta coach Les Hamilton

Isi Sofele

RB, Cottonwood High School

Signed with California

Coach's comment: "He was so explosive, such a good athlete. You definitely wanted to keep him under wraps. If he gets out in the open he's so dangerous. Everything we did defensively was to try and contain him."

— Highland coach Brody Benson

Latu Heimuli

DL, Highland High School

Signed with Utah

Coach's comment: "Latu was definitely a kid we had to prepare for. He is a great player and a kid I thought could really hurt us when we played Highland. He's a big, physical presence."

— Cottonwood coach Cecil Thomas
